Composed by Rachel Portman. Arranged by Rebecca Belliston. Contemporary,Film/TV,New Age. Score. 3 pages. Rebecca Belliston #4728521. Published by Rebecca Belliston (A0.726898).

Piano Solo Arrangement: "Main Title" from the movie The Cider House Rules. Also known as the "Pure Michigan Theme Song"

About the Arranger

Rebecca Lund Belliston has been writing songs since she was six, teaching piano since she was sixteen, and has a song stuck in her head at all times. As a lover of classical and religious music, she composes mostly for piano and vocal. In addition, Rebecca also writes romantic suspense novels. She and her husband have five children and live in the beautiful state of Michigan. Find her online at rebeccabelliston.com.
